Ingredients
Scale
- 1/2 cup salted butter
- 1/2 cup buttermilk
- 1 cup sugar
- 1/2 cup corn syrup
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 teaspoon coconut extract
Instructions
- In a large saucepan over medium heat, combine the butter, buttermilk, sugar, and corn syrup. Bring the mixture to a rapid boil while stirring.
- Boil for 2-3 minutes, or just until the mixture starts to caramelize.
- Remove from the heat and whisk in the baking soda, vanilla extract, and coconut extract. Stir until combined, then allow for it to cool for 5 minutes before serving.
- Store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 weeks.
Notes
- This sauce can be used as a topping for ice cream, pancakes, or desserts.
- Make sure to stir constantly while boiling to prevent burning.
